NELLI Spring Drive - 04/27/08

NELLI is having their first drive of the year on Sunday, April 27. The have extended an offer to any E-Talk members who would like to join in. Here are the details. If anyone is interested please let me know by the 22nd and then I can forward your information to NELLI.

NELLI Spring Drive April 2008

NELLI's first official event of the year will be a tour of eastern Connecticut on Sunday April 27th.

We will meet at 10:00 am in Sturbridge, MA in the parking lot of Rom's Restaurant located on Rt. 131S about one mile south of Rt. 20 on the right. From there we will take 131 south to Southbridge and catch Rt. 169 off to the right just past the center of town.

We will cruise down scenic Rt. 169 until we get to Norwich. In Norwich we will head east on Rt. 82 and visit Gillette Castle State Park. The castle itself does not open until memorial Day but I am told the scenic vistas are terrific. After the stop at the castle we will continue on 82 for a short distance until we get to East Haddam where we will stop for lunch at the Gelston House (plenty of parking behind). http://www.gelstonhouse.com/

After lunch we will start the trek back to Sturbridge taking Rt. 149 north to Rt. 2 west to Rt. 66 north joining onto Rt. 6 east to Rt. 198 north which will get us back to Southbridge, MA. Taking 131 north will get us back to Sturbridge where one can catch either Rt. 84 or Rt. 90.

For those who have not had enough and would like to sample some local suds we could proceed to the Pioneer Brewing Company in nearby Fiskdale. http://www.hylandbrew.com

Those planning to attend please e-mail to let me know so we don't leave without you. Please let me know before Wednesday the 23rd so that lunch reservations can be made.
